文章分类 -  PHP

上一页 1 2 3 4 5 6 ··· 38 下一页
摘要:摘要 不仅最古老的函数式语言Lisp重获青春,而且新的函数式语言层出不穷,比如Erlang、clojure、Scala、F#等等。目前最当红的Python、Ruby、Javascript,对函数式编程的支持都很强,就连老牌的面向对象的Java、面向过程的PHP,都忙不迭地加入对匿名函数的支持。越来越 阅读全文
posted @ 2019-07-20 16:38 天涯海角路 阅读(87) 评论(0) 推荐(0)
摘要:实例 创建一个包含从 "0" 到 "5" 之间的元素范围的数组: <?php $number = range(0,5); print_r ($number); ?> 运行实例 实例 创建一个包含从 "0" 到 "5" 之间的元素范围的数组: 运行实例 定义和用法 range() 函数创建一个包含指定 阅读全文
posted @ 2019-05-20 23:30 天涯海角路 阅读(123) 评论(0) 推荐(0)
摘要:本篇文章给大家带来的内容是关于php中九种数学函数的总结,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。 1.求最大值 max() echo max(array(4,5,6)); //6 echo max(array(4,5,6)); //6 2.求最小值 min() echo mi 阅读全文
posted @ 2019-05-20 23:14 天涯海角路 阅读(196) 评论(0) 推荐(0)
摘要:number_format()函数是PHP中的一个内置函数,用于格式化一个包含数千个分组的数字。它在成功时返回格式化的数字,否则在失败时给出E_WARNING。 语法: string number_format ( $number, $decimals, $decimalpoint, $sep ) 阅读全文
posted @ 2019-05-20 23:08 天涯海角路 阅读(1297) 评论(0) 推荐(0)
摘要:PHP手册:die()Equivalent to exit()。 说明:die()和exit()都是中止脚本执行函数;其实exit和die这两个名字指向的是同一个函数,die()是exit()函数的别名。该函数只接受一个参数,可以是一个程序返回的数值或是一个字符串,也可以不输入参数,结果没有返回值。 阅读全文
posted @ 2019-05-20 22:46 天涯海角路 阅读(256) 评论(0) 推荐(0)
摘要:【1】单引号和双引号在处理变量的时候做法: 括在双引号内的变量会解释出值,但是括在单引号内则不做处理,直接输出; 1 2 3 4 5 6 7 <?php $var = 'my name is huige'; echo "$var"; //结果是:my name is huige echo '$var 阅读全文
posted @ 2019-05-20 22:08 天涯海角路 阅读(880) 评论(0) 推荐(0)
摘要:看好多代码有时候用单引号或双引号实现包含字符串的内容,其实简单个概括下双引号中的变量可以解析,单引号就是绝对的字符串。 看好多代码有时候用单引号或双引号实现包含字符串的内容,其实简单个概括下双引号中的变量可以解析,单引号就是绝对的字符串。 1、定义字符串 在PHP中,字符串的定义可以使用单引号,也可 阅读全文
posted @ 2019-05-20 22:07 天涯海角路 阅读(2220) 评论(0) 推荐(0)
摘要:PHP单引号及双引号均可以修饰字符串类型的数据,如果修饰的字符串中含有变量(例$name);最大的区别是: 双引号会替换变量的值,而单引号会把它当做字符串输出。 转义字符,顾名思义会将规定的语法用"\"来输出。但语法规定在不同的系统中转义字符的作用不同,例如:windows下的回车换行符用"\r"或 阅读全文
posted @ 2019-05-20 22:03 天涯海角路 阅读(7213) 评论(0) 推荐(0)
摘要:抽象类abstract class1 .抽象类是指在 class 前加了 abstract 关键字且存在抽象方法(在类方法 function 关键字前加了 abstract 关键字)的类。2 .抽象类不能被直接实例化。抽象类中只定义(或部分实现)子类需要的方法。子类可以通过继承抽象类并通过实现抽象类 阅读全文
posted @ 2019-05-20 21:54 天涯海角路 阅读(101) 评论(0) 推荐(0)
摘要:首先,看看什么是抽象类和接口 抽象类: 定义为抽象的类不能被实例化.任何一个类,如果它里面至少有一个方法是被声明为抽象的,那么这个类就必须被声明为抽象的。被定义为抽象的方法只是声明了其调用方式(参数),不能定义其具体的功能实现。继承一个抽象类的时候,子类必须定义父类中的所有抽象方法;另外,这些方法的 阅读全文
posted @ 2019-05-20 21:53 天涯海角路 阅读(96) 评论(0) 推荐(0)
摘要:1.this this是指向当前对象实例的指针,是在实例化的时候来确定指向谁,不指向任何其他对象或类 2.self self是指向类本身,简单点说self是不指向任何已经实例化的对象,一般self使用来指向类中的静态变量,而静态变量只和类有关,和对象的实例无关。假如我们使用类里面静态(一般用关键字s 阅读全文
posted @ 2019-05-20 21:49 天涯海角路 阅读(142) 评论(0) 推荐(0)
摘要:1.self代表类,$this代表对象2.能用$this的地方一定使用self,能用self的地方不一定能用$this静态的方法中不能使用$this,静态方法给类访问的。 今天在使用静态方法的时候,使用了$this去调用对象的属性,导致曝出错误信息,在网上查询了手册和百度, 发现大部分回答只是说明了 阅读全文
posted @ 2019-05-20 21:47 天涯海角路 阅读(177) 评论(0) 推荐(0)
摘要:this,self,parent三个关键字从字面上比较好理解,分别是指这、自己、父亲。 this是指向当前对象的指针(姑且用C里面的指针来看吧)self是指向当前类的指针parent是指向父类的指针(我们这里频繁使用指针来描述,是因为没有更好的语言来表达) 根据实际的例子来看看(1) this1 2 阅读全文
posted @ 2019-05-20 21:45 天涯海角路 阅读(115) 评论(0) 推荐(0)
摘要:php中除了常规类和方法的使用,访问控制之外,还有静态关键字static,静态变量可以是局部变量也可以是全局变量,当一个程序段执行完毕时,静态变量并没有消失,它依然存在于内存中,下次在定义时还是以前的值,常用于递归或子函数中保留之前的值,可以用来定义变量和方法,作用就不具体说了,说一下使用方式,下面 阅读全文
posted @ 2019-05-20 21:43 天涯海角路 阅读(118) 评论(0) 推荐(0)
摘要:一直依赖对于php中static关键字比较模糊,只是在单例模式中用过几次。上网查了查,没有找到很全的介绍,自己总结一下。 根据使用位置分为两部分 1、函数体中的静态变量 2、类中的静态属性和方法 1 函数体中的静态变量 static $a = 1; function num1(){ static $ 阅读全文
posted @ 2019-05-20 21:39 天涯海角路 阅读(247) 评论(0) 推荐(0)
摘要:阐述:使用PHP语言有一段时间了,今天看见某段代码中的global 变量。突然脑海中想到global 和 $GLOBALS区别是什么呢? 1), global 变量名,示例代码如下:输出结果为: 2), $GLOBALS 变量名,示例代码:输出结果为:总结:众所周知局部变量无法再函数外访问,可以使用 阅读全文
posted @ 2019-05-20 21:36 天涯海角路 阅读(474) 评论(0) 推荐(0)
摘要:PHP作为一个脚本的解释型语言,弱变量的特点和执行完释放资源的特点诸城,PHP7的强势加入更是在后端语言的群雄中掀起了一阵强烈的旋风。好了,由于本人我平时也不怎么注意变量的作用域,由此写这篇文章也算是自我提醒。 而PHP的语法特点和c++也比较像,再加上$_POST,$FILE等全局变量和__con 阅读全文
posted @ 2019-05-20 21:33 天涯海角路 阅读(1939) 评论(0) 推荐(0)
摘要:1、可变变量 简而言之:获取一个普通变量的值作为这个可变变量的变量名。 如: $a = "hello";$$a = " world";/* $a 的值为"hello" $$a -> ${$a} ->$hello,也就是说$$a等价于$hello*/echo $a.$$a;//输出结果为 hello 阅读全文
posted @ 2019-05-20 21:32 天涯海角路 阅读(222) 评论(0) 推荐(0)
摘要:php中,由于作用域的限制,导致变量的访问限制: 1、局部作用域内不能访问全局变量 2、全局作用域内不能访问局部变量 对于第一种情况,如下代码将不能正常运行: 那么要想在局部作用域内正常使用全局作用域变量,该怎么做呢? 方法一:在局部作用域内,使用global关键字声明与全局作用域变量名称相同的变量 阅读全文
posted @ 2019-05-20 21:30 天涯海角路 阅读(602) 评论(0) 推荐(0)
摘要:超全局变量 在 PHP 4.1.0 中引入,是在全部作用域中始终可用的内置变量。 PHP 中的许多预定义变量都是“超全局的”,这意味着它们在一个脚本的全部作用域中都可用。在函数或方法中无需执行 global $variable; 就可以访问它们。 常用的超全局变量有9个: 1. $_GET –> g 阅读全文
posted @ 2019-05-20 21:29 天涯海角路 阅读(597) 评论(0) 推荐(0)

上一页 1 2 3 4 5 6 ··· 38 下一页